随着信息技术的迅猛发展,数据存储的方式也在不断演进。传统的集中式存储虽然在过去的几十年中发展得非常成熟,但随着数据安全和隐私保护问题的日益突出,分布式存储方案开始受到越来越多的关注。区块链作为一种去中心化的技术,其分布式存储特性为数据存储提供了全新的解决方案。本文将深入解析区块链分布式存储的概念、原理、优势及其在各个领域的应用案例,同时对区块链分布式储存存在的挑战与未来发展方向展开讨论。
一、区块链分布式储存的基本概念
区块链是一种以加密方式保护数据的分布式账本技术,能够在去中心化的网络中高效、安全地记录和验证交易。与传统的集中式数据库相比,区块链的主要优势在于其不可篡改性和透明性,这使得其在数据存储与管理方面具有了独特的能力。
分布式存储是指在多个节点上存储数据,而不是仅仅依赖一个中心服务器。这种方式不仅提高了数据安全性,也增加了系统的可靠性和可用性。区块链分布式存储正是将这两者结合,形成了一种新的数据管理模式。
二、区块链分布式储存的工作原理
区块链分布式存储的核心理念是将数据以区块的形式存储在多个节点上。这些节点组成了一个网络,数据在全网进行广播,每个节点都保存着完整的数据记录。数据的写入、删除及更新操作都需要经过全网节点的验证和共识,保证数据的一致性与可靠性。
具体来说,当一笔交易发生时,首先会生成一个包含该交易信息的区块,并将其广播到网络中的所有节点。各个节点通过使用算法(如工作量证明或权益证明)进行竞争,决定谁可以先将该区块添加到区块链中。一旦区块被确认并加入到链中,就无法被修改或删除。这样就形成了一个安全、可靠的交易记录系统。
三、区块链分布式储存的优势
区块链分布式储存的优势主要体现在以下几个方面:
1. **去中心化**:数据不再集中存储在某一服务器上,因此减少了单点故障的风险。同时,去中心化也意味着数据掌握在用户手中,提升了用户对数据的控制权。
2. **安全性高**:由于区块链的设计使得任何数据一旦被写入后都无法篡改,这极大地增强了数据存储的安全性。此外,数据经过加密处理,可以有效防止未授权的访问。
3. **透明性与可追溯性**:区块链上的每一笔交易都是公开的,任何人都可以查询到相关的数据记录,因此系统的透明性得以增强。同时,数据的历史记录可以追溯,有助于审计和合规。
4. **容错性**:由于数据存储在多个节点,若某个节点出现故障,其它节点仍然可以继续运作,确保数据的可用性。这种设计抵御了数据丢失或损坏的风险。
5. **降低成本**:尽管区块链存储的初期建设可能需要投入一定的技术和资源,但从长远来看,通过去掉中间环节及降低运营成本,将会显著节省数据管理的开支。
四、区块链分布式储存的应用案例
区块链分布式储存在多个领域都展现出了巨大的应用潜力,以下是一些典型案例:
1. **金融行业**:在金融行业,区块链技术通过提供安全的存储和传输渠道,提高了支付、结算的效率和安全性。例如,某些银行正在使用区块链来处理国际汇款,这样不仅速度快,还能降低费用。
2. **医疗健康**:医疗数据具有极高的隐私性,区块链可以为患者的数据提供安全保障,通过去中心化的存储,不同的医疗机构可以在保护患者隐私的情况下共享数据,同时追踪数据来源。
3. **供应链管理**:区块链能够提高供应链的透明度,有助于追踪产品制造和运输的各个环节,确保产品的真实性与质量。在食品供应链中,消费者可以通过区块链查询产品的来源。
4. **数字身份**:区块链提供了一种新的数字身份验证方式,使得每个人能在确保隐私的情况下,安全地管理自己的身份信息。在一些国家,区块链技术已经被用于发放电子身份证。
5. **文件存储和验证**:区块链技术也可以用于文件存储,如合同、许可证等文档的安全存储及其真实性验证,提高文档的管理效率,同时降低伪造的风险。
五、区块链分布式储存面临的挑战
虽然区块链分布式储存展现出诸多优势,但也面临一些挑战:
1. **技术门槛**:区块链技术相对复杂,很多企业在实施过程中会面临技术上的困难,如基础设施建设、现有系统的集成等问题。
2. **性能问题**:当前区块链网络的交易处理速度较慢,难以满足高频率的交易需求。此外,区块链的大量节点保存数据也会在存储和带宽上带来压力。
3. **法律与监管**:区块链的去中心化特性使其在法律和监管上面临一定的挑战。传统法律框架难以适应区块链技术的发展,导致在合规性方面仍有待解决的问题。
4. **数据隐私问题**:区块链虽然提供了透明性,但这种透明性也可能带来数据隐私的顾虑。如何在保护隐私的同时实现有效的数据共享仍需技术上的改进。
5. **能耗**:区块链网络的共识机制(尤其是工作量证明)需要消耗大量的能源,如何实现绿色、可持续的发展是当前区块链面临的重要问题。
六、未来发展方向
针对区块链分布式存储面临的挑战,未来的发展可能会朝着以下几个方向发展:
1. **技术创新**:随着技术的不断进步,新型的共识机制(如权益证明 POS 等)有望解决当前区块链在性能与能耗上的问题,使得区块链更为高效。
2. **标准化**:行业的标准化将会推动区块链技术的发展,促进不同区块链之间的互操作性,从而提高应用的广泛性与灵活性。
3. **法律框架完善**:各国政府和行业组织将需要加快制定相关法律法规,以适应区块链技术的发展与应用,保障用户的合法权益。
4. **隐私保护技术的进步**:隐私计算、同态加密等技术的发展将为区块链提供更强的数据隐私保护能力,使得区块链在合规和隐私保护方面更加成熟。
5. **可持续发展**:探索区块链技术的绿色认证方案,降低其能耗是未来技术进步的重要方向,同时实现可持续的生态布局。
七、可能相关问题
在深入理解区块链分布式储存的过程中,读者可能会遇到以下相关问题,接下来将对这些问题进行详细解答。
1. 区块链为什么能确保数据安全?
区块链的安全机制主要依赖于其独特的结构和加密技术。每一个区块都包含了交易数据、时间戳以及上一个区块的哈希值等信息,这种结构使得任何对区块链中数据的修改都会影响到后续的所有区块,从而导致哈希值不一致。在区块链网络中,为了达到数据一致性,攻击者需要同时控制网络中的大部分节点,这在实际操作中几乎是不可能的。
其次,区块链使用的加密技术也进一步增强了数据的安全性。对每个区块的数据进行加密,即使数据被截获,非授权方也无法解密。此外,公众链的每一个交易都是公开透明的,所有用户都可以随时查阅和验证,配合去中心化存储,确保了的数据安全性。
2. 区块链分布式存储适用于哪些行业?
区块链分布式存储已在多个行业展现出应用潜力,最为典型的包括金融、医疗、供应链、数字身份、知识产权以及社交网络等领域。在金融方面,区块链可以用于跨境支付,快速、安全地进行资产转移;在医疗行业,患者的医疗数据可以通过区块链安全存储,便于医生获取和管理,从而提升医疗效率。
供应链行业利用区块链可以真实追踪产品的来源及供应链环节,提升透明度。数字身份管理则可以通过区块链实现去中心化的身份验证,保护用户隐私。知识产权方面,通过区块链可以对创作内容的版权进行有效管理,防止侵权行为。总之,几乎所有需要安全、高效和透明存储数据的行业都可能受益于区块链分布式存储。
3. 区块链的去中心化如何影响数据存储和管理?
区块链的去中心化改变了传统数据存储和管理的方式。与集中式存储不同,去中心化意味着数据不由单个实体或服务器控制,而是由整个网络中的多个节点共同维护。这种设计使得数据在网络中提高了容错性和安全性。即使某个节点发生了故障,其他节点仍能继续工作,从而保证数据的可用性。
此外,去中心化能有效减少中介机构的介入,降低了管理成本,也提高了交易的透明度。用户在区块链中拥有对数据的直接控制权,增强了数据的安全性和隐私保护。最后,由于去中心化的特点,数据的完整性和真实性得到保障,保护用户利益,强化用户与平台之间的信任关系。
4. 如何解决区块链分布式存储中的能耗问题?
区块链的能耗问题主要体现在有效的共识机制上,特别是工作量证明(PoW)机制被广泛批评为消耗过多的能源。因此,为了解决这一问题,许多项目正在探讨和研发更为高效的共识机制,如权益证明(PoS)、委托权益证明(DPoS)等机制。这些机制能够在降低能耗的同时,确保网络的安全性和可靠性。
此外,通过使用侧链和链下解决方案,可以减少主链上的交易负载,从而相应降低能耗。同时,也有项目致力于开发绿色区块链,通过使用可再生能源来支持网络的运作,从而在确保良好的性能的同时,还能降低环境影响。这些策略都将有助于提升区块链在能耗上的可持续性。
5. 区块链如何实现数据的隐私保护?
区块链虽然以透明性著称,但在隐私保护方面也有不少技术手段。首先是通过加密技术来保护数据,用户在上链之前对数据进行加密处理,只有授权用户才能获取解密钥匙,从而保护数据的隐私。其次是使用环签名、零知识证明等隐私保护技术,使得用户的身份和交易内容在一定程度上得到隐藏,保障用户隐私。
例如,Monero和Zcash作为隐私币,使用了一系列复杂的加密算法,确保交易的匿名性。此外还有分层加密和同态加密等技术可以进一步提升数据的隐私保护能力。总的来说,未来区块链在隐私保护方面还有很多可以探索的技术方向,能够更好地解决当前数据隐私问题。
总结来说,区块链分布式储存作为未来数据存储的重要一环,具有颠覆传统存储模式的潜力。虽然仍面临着诸多挑战,但随着技术的不断发展与成熟,区块链在各行各业的应用前景无疑将更加广阔。
